We think this is still a problem and the issue relates to the default pickslip processing.

If we have an order with location 1 assigned to the order with a defined picking sequence assigned, the picking sequence prints properly.

If we have a backorder and decide to ship from another location (say 03) with the default picking sequence, the default picking sequence does not print.

You can test this and see this with sample data, just by doing an inquiry or a grid view on picking sequences by locations for an item with defaults. The picking sequence is blank in the tables and onscreen inquiry of quantities by location (checkout the picking sequence details).

What we would like is to be able to print picking slips with picking sequences for any location, that pick up the revised picking sequence when the location changes without have to re-enter the line on the order again, given that the revised location on the backordered item is already correct.
